To Maj General Don Carlos Buell
August 12, 1862
From the best information I can get there is but about 20,000 men including levies or conscripts in front on my left at Corinth - the main body having gone to Chattanooga - the rail book at Mobile shows that 56,000 have passed by Rail from Tupelo and vicinity to Chattanooga. The person who gave me this information and whom I believe reliable... says the whole rebel force at Chattanooga belonging to that command is estimated at 108,000.
I will telegraph you again during the day and inform you what I have done for your support in case of need.
U.S. Grant
Corinth, Mississippi.
